/*
Theme Name: Slow Loris Media
Theme URI: http://slowlorismedia.com
Description: Custom template for Slow Loris Media
Version: 1.0
Author: Jesse Keyes and Josh Leo
Author URI: http://jessekeyes.com/

*/





/**** The Grid ****/

.container_12,.container_16{margin-left:auto;margin-right:auto;width:960px}.grid_1,.grid_2,.grid_3,.grid_4,.grid_5,.grid_6,.grid_7,.grid_8,.grid_9,.grid_10,.grid_11,.grid_12,.grid_13,.grid_14,.grid_15,.grid_16{display:inline;float:left;margin-left:10px;margin-right:10px}.container_12 .grid_3,.container_16 .grid_4{width:220px}.container_12 .grid_6,.container_16 .grid_8{width:460px}.container_12 .grid_9,.container_16 .grid_12{width:700px}.container_12 .grid_12,.container_16 .grid_16{width:940px}.alpha{margin-left:0}.omega{margin-right:0}.container_12 .grid_1{width:60px}.container_12 .grid_2{width:140px}.container_12 .grid_4{width:300px}.container_12 .grid_5{width:380px}.container_12 .grid_7{width:540px}.container_12 .grid_8{width:620px}.container_12 .grid_10{width:780px}.container_12 .grid_11{width:860px}.container_16 .grid_1{width:40px}.container_16 .grid_2{width:100px}.container_16 .grid_3{width:160px}.container_16 .grid_5{width:280px}.container_16 .grid_6{width:340px}.container_16 .grid_7{width:400px}.container_16 .grid_9{width:520px}.container_16 .grid_10{width:580px}.container_16 .grid_11{width:640px}.container_16 .grid_13{width:760px}.container_16 .grid_14{width:820px}.container_16 .grid_15{width:880px}.container_12 .prefix_3,.container_16 .prefix_4{padding-left:240px}.container_12 .prefix_6,.container_16 .prefix_8{padding-left:480px}.container_12 .prefix_9,.container_16 .prefix_12{padding-left:720px}.container_12 .prefix_1{padding-left:80px}.container_12 .prefix_2{padding-left:160px}.container_12 .prefix_4{padding-left:320px}.container_12 .prefix_5{padding-left:400px}.container_12 .prefix_7{padding-left:560px}.container_12 .prefix_8{padding-left:640px}.container_12 .prefix_10{padding-left:800px}.container_12 .prefix_11{padding-left:880px}.container_16 .prefix_1{padding-left:60px}.container_16 .prefix_2{padding-left:120px}.container_16 .prefix_3{padding-left:180px}.container_16 .prefix_5{padding-left:300px}.container_16 .prefix_6{padding-left:360px}.container_16 .prefix_7{padding-left:420px}.container_16 .prefix_9{padding-left:540px}.container_16 .prefix_10{padding-left:600px}.container_16 .prefix_11{padding-left:660px}.container_16 .prefix_13{padding-left:780px}.container_16 .prefix_14{padding-left:840px}.container_16 .prefix_15{padding-left:900px}.container_12 .suffix_3,.container_16 .suffix_4{padding-right:240px}.container_12 .suffix_6,.container_16 .suffix_8{padding-right:480px}.container_12 .suffix_9,.container_16 .suffix_12{padding-right:720px}.container_12 .suffix_1{padding-right:80px}.container_12 .suffix_2{padding-right:160px}.container_12 .suffix_4{padding-right:320px}.container_12 .suffix_5{padding-right:400px}.container_12 .suffix_7{padding-right:560px}.container_12 .suffix_8{padding-right:640px}.container_12 .suffix_10{padding-right:800px}.container_12 .suffix_11{padding-right:880px}.container_16 .suffix_1{padding-right:60px}.container_16 .suffix_2{padding-right:120px}.container_16 .suffix_3{padding-right:180px}.container_16 .suffix_5{padding-right:300px}.container_16 .suffix_6{padding-right:360px}.container_16 .suffix_7{padding-right:420px}.container_16 .suffix_9{padding-right:540px}.container_16 .suffix_10{padding-right:600px}.container_16 .suffix_11{padding-right:660px}.container_16 .suffix_13{padding-right:780px}.container_16 .suffix_14{padding-right:840px}.container_16 .suffix_15{padding-right:900px}.clear{clear:both;display:block;overflow:hidden;visibility:hidden;width:0;height:0}.clearfix:after{clear:both;content:' ';display:block;font-size:0;line-height:0;visibility:hidden;width:0;height:0}.clearfix{display:inline-block}* html .clearfix{height:1%}.clearfix{display:block}


/** reset **/

* {
	margin: 0;
	padding: 0;
}

div.clear
{
height: 1%;
clear: both;
content: ".";
height: 0;
visibility: hidden;
}




/**** styles ****/


/** font face! **/

@font-face {
font-family: 'Museo-Slab';
src: url('/phontz/Museo_Slab_500.otf');
src: url('/phontz/Museo_Slab_500.otf'), local('Museo Slab 500')  format('truetype');
}

@font-face {
font-family: 'Adelle';
src: url('/phontz/AdelleBasic_Bold.otf');
src: url('/phontz/AdelleBasic_Bold.otf'), local('Adelle Basic Bold') format('truetype');
}





/** structure **/



#wrapper {
	width: 1018px;
	background: url(img/content-tile.png) repeat-y;
	min-height:100%; /* gives layout 100% height */
	
}

* html #wrapper { 
height:100%; /* IE6 treats height as min-height */
}


#content {
	margin-left: -15px;
	padding-bottom: 260px; /* for the footer */
}

#header {
	height: 160px;
	width: 1018px;
	margin: 0;
	background: url(img/header-second.jpg) no-repeat;
}

.blog-side{
	margin-top: 63px;
	
}

#footer-wrap{
	width: 1000px;
}

#footer {
	height: 260px;
	width: 1000px;
	margin:-260px 0 0 0px;
	background: url(img/footer-back.jpg) no-repeat;
	float: left;
}


/*** globals ***/

html, body {
height:100%; /* gives layout 100% height */
}


body {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 14px;
	line-height: 16px;
	color: #fff;
	background: #eae0d0;
}


a {
	color: #9f5523;
	text-decoration: none;
}


a:hover {
	text-decoration: underline;
	}
	

p {
	margin-bottom: 20px;
	line-height: 20px;
}



h1,h2,h3 {
	margin-bottom: 10px;
	font-family: Palatino;
}

h1#blogname {
	display: none;
}

a#home {
	display: block;
	width:400px;
	height: 80px;
	margin: 6px 0 0 30px;
}


.entry ul li, blockquote {
	margin: 0 30px 5px;
}

.entry ul li {
	margin-left: 43px;
}

.pagey blockquote {
	font-family: Museo-Slab, Palatino, serif;
	font-size: 20px;
	color: #9f5523;
}

hr {
	border: #503826 solid 1px;
	height: px;	
}


/**** header ****/


/* front */

#front-left {
	float: left;
	margin: 50px 0 0 50px;
	width: 410px;
}

#front-left img, .fronty img {
	border: none;
}


#front-right {
	background: url(img/vid-back.png) no-repeat;
	float: left;
	margin: 60px 0 0 50px;
	width: 482px;
	height: 293px;

}

#front-right object, #front-right iframe {
	margin: 4px 0 0 20px;
}

#front-right object embed{
	margin: 4px 0 0 0;
}


.fronty {
	margin: 0 0 0 40px !important;
	width: 1015px !important;
}

#mod-left {
	width:290px;
	float:left;
	text-align: center;
	padding-right: 10px;
}



#mod-middle {
	width:290px;
	float:left;
	text-align: center;
	padding-left: 10px;
	padding-right: 10px;
}

#mod-right {
	width:280px;
	float:left;
	text-align: center;
	padding-left: 10px;
	padding-right: 10px;

}


.mod-rule {
	float: left;
	margin: 95px 10px 0 10px;
}


#mod-left p, #mod-right p, #mod-middle p {
	text-align: left;
	margin-top: 5px;
	}

#quote {
	margin: 40px auto 50px 90px;
}


/* menu drop down */

ul#menu {
	margin: -45px 30px 0 0;
	float: right;
	font-family: Museo-Slab, Palatino, serif;
	font-size: 18px;
}

ul.dropdown,
ul.dropdown li,
ul.dropdown ul {
 list-style: none;
 margin: 0;
 padding: 0;
}

ul.dropdown {
 position: relative;
 z-index: 597;
 float: left;
}

ul.dropdown li {
 float: left;
 line-height: 1.3em;
 vertical-align: middle;
 zoom: 1;
	margin-left: 5px;
	padding-left: 5px;
	border-left: #a49a82 1px solid;
}

ul.dropdown li.first_item {
	margin-left: 0px;
	padding-left: 0px;
	border-left: none;
}

ul.dropdown li a:hover, ul.dropdown  li.current_page_item a, ul.dropdown li.current_page_item ul li a:hover  {
	
}


ul.dropdown li.current_page_item ul li a { /* for drop downs not to take hover effect of parent */
	background: #ddd;
}


ul.dropdown li.hover,
ul.dropdown li:hover {
 position: relative;
 z-index: 599;
 cursor: default;
}

ul.dropdown ul {
 visibility: hidden;
 position: absolute;
 top: 100%;
 left: 0;
 z-index: 598;
 min-width:150px;
	border: 1px solid black;
	background: white;
}

ul.dropdown ul li {
 float: none;
}

ul.dropdown ul li a {
	display: block;
	padding: 5px;
	width: 140%;
}

ul.dropdown ul ul {
 top: 1px;
 left: 99%;
}

ul.dropdown li:hover > ul {
 visibility: visible;
}





ul.dropdown li.rtl ul {
 top: 100%;
 right: 0;
 left: auto;
}

ul.dropdown li.rtl ul ul {
 top: 1px;
 right: 99%;
 left: auto;
}





/**** content ****/




.post {
	margin:10px 10px 40px 10px;
}

.entry {

}

.entry h3 {
	color: #9f5523;
	font-size: 30px;
	font-family: Museo-Slab, Palatino, serif;
	margin-bottom: 20px;
	
}


h2.title a, h3.title a, h2.title {
	color: #fff;
	font-size: 24px;
	line-height: 26px;
}


h2.pagetitle {
	margin: 10px 0 20px -80px;
	padding-bottom: 7px;
	border-bottom: 1px solid #9F5523;
	color: #e0d0a9;
}


h2.thepagetitle {
	font-family: Museo-Slab, Palatino, serif;
	font-size: 39px;
	color: #e0d0a9;
}

h2.blogtitle {
	padding-bottom: 30px;
	margin: 20px 0 0 -80px
}

.navigation {
	margin: 10px;
}

p.postmetadata {
	color: #E0D0A9;
	font-size: 11px;
}

p.alt {
	padding: 5px;
}


.more {
	color: #e0d0a9;
	font-size: 11px;
}

div.date {
	text-align: center;
	background: url(img/date-cir.png) no-repeat center;
	width: 57px;
	height: 57px;
	float: left;
	margin: -30px 0 0 -70px;
}

div.date p {
	font-family: "Museo Slab 500", Palatino;
	color: #e0d0a9;
	font-size: 18px;
	padding-top: 10px;
	padding-left: 2px;
	margin-bottom: 0;
	
}


.pagey {
	padding-left: 40px;
	padding-top: 20px;
}






.pagey .post {
	padding-left: 30px;
	padding-top: 30px;
}

.tan {
	color: #e0d0a9;
	font-size: 16px;
}

.whoami {
	width:440px !important;
}


.whatido {
	float: right;
	width: 390px;
}


.testimonials p {
	font-family: Palatino, serif;
	font-size: 20px;
	line-height: 24px;
	color:#9F5523;
	margin-left: 70px;
	margin-right: 70px;
	
}

.testimonials img {
	border: 0 !important;
}

.testimonials blockquote {
	margin-left: 0;
	margin-right: 0;
	margin-bottom: 20px;
	border-bottom: #503826 solid 1px;
	padding: 20px 0;
}

.testimonials blockquote p {
	font-family: Palatino, serif;
	font-size: 16px;
	color: #e0d0a9;
	margin-bottom: 0;
	}

/* Captions */
.aligncenter,
div.aligncenter {
	display: block;
	margin-left: auto;
	margin-right: auto;
	padding: 5px;

}

.wp-caption {
	border: 1px solid #ddd;
	text-align: center;
	background-color: #f3f3f3;
	margin: 10px;
	-moz-border-radius: 3px;
	-khtml-border-radius: 3px;
	-webkit-border-radius: 3px;
	border-radius: 3px;
	padding-bottom: 0px !important;
}

.wp-caption img {
	margin: 0;
	padding: 0;
	border: 0 none;
}

.wp-caption p.wp-caption-text {
	font-size: 11px;
	line-height: 17px;
	padding: 0;
	margin: 5px !important;
}

.alignleft {
	float: left;
	padding: 5px;
}

.alignright {
	float: right;
	padding: 5px;
}


	
img.alignright {
	float: right;
	margin: 5px 0px 5px 10px;
	padding: 0;
	}

img.alignleft {
	float: left;
	margin: 5px 10px 5px 0;
	padding: 0;
	}
	
img.aligncenter {
	margin: 0 auto;
	padding: 10px;
	clear:both;
	}

.entry p img {
	border: #503826 8px solid;
}


/* End captions */




/*	Comments									*/

#comments-wrap {
	margin: 10px;
}
	
.commentlist li ul li {
	font-size: 12px;
	}

.commentlist li {
	font-weight: bold;
	}

.commentlist li .avatar { 
	background: #FFFFFF;
	float: right;
	border: 1px solid #EEEEEE;
	margin: 0px 5px 0px 10px;
	padding: 2px;
	}

.commentlist cite, .commentlist cite a {
	font-weight: bold;
	font-style: normal;
	}

.commentlist p {
	font-weight: normal;
	text-transform: none;
	}

.commentmetadata {
	font-weight: normal;
	}

#commentform input {
	width: 170px;
	padding: 2px;
	margin: 5px 5px 1px 0px;
	}

#commentform {
	margin: 5px 10px 0px 0px;
	}
	
#commentform textarea {
	width: 100%;
	padding: 2px;
	}
	
#respond:after {
	content: "."; 
	display: block; 
	height: 0px; 
	clear: both; 
	visibility: hidden;
	}
	
#commentform p {
	margin: 5px 0px 5px 0px;
	}
	
#commentform #submit {
	margin: 10px 0;
	float: left;
	}
	
.alt {
	margin: 0px;
	padding: 10px;
	color: #E0D0A9;
	}
	
.even {
	background: #503826;
}

.commentlist {
	margin: 0px;
	padding: 0px;
	}
	
.commentlist ol {
	margin: 0px;
	padding: 10px;
	}

.commentlist li {
	margin: 15px 0px 10px;
	padding: 10px 5px 10px 10px;
	list-style: none;

	}
.commentlist li ul li { 
	margin-right: -5px;
	margin-left: 10px;
	}

.commentlist p {
	margin: 10px 5px 10px 0px;
	padding: 0px;
	}
	
.children { 
	margin: 0px;
	padding: 0px;
	}

.nocomments {
	text-align: center;
	margin: 0px;
	padding: 0px;
	}

.commentmetadata {
	font-size: 10px;
	margin: 0px;
	display: block;
	}

.navigation {
	display: block;
	text-align: center;
	margin-top: 10px;
	margin-bottom: 40px;
	}
	
.alignright {
	float: right;
	}

.alignleft {
	float: left;
	}
	
.thread-alt {
	background: #FFFFFF;
	margin: 0px;
	padding: 0px;
	}
	
.thread-even {
	background: #EEEEEE;
	margin: 0px;
	padding: 0px;
	}
	
.depth-1 {
	border: 1px dotted #BBBBBB;
	margin: 0px;
	padding: 0px;
	}

.even, .alt {
	border: 1px dotted #E0D0A9;
	margin: 0px;
	padding: 0px;
	}
	






/**** sidebar ****/

/* sidebar lists, widgets */
#sidebar ul {
	margin: 10px;
}

#sidebar ul li {
	list-style: none;
}

#sidebar ul li.widget {
	padding-bottom: 20px;
}

#sidebar ul li ul li {
	list-style-image: url(img/bullet.png);
	margin-left: 00px;
	color: #e0d0a9;
	font-size: 11px;

}

#sidebar ul li ul li a{
	color: #e0d0a9;
	font-size: 11px;
}

#sidebar ul li ul li ul {
	margin: 5px 0;
	}

#sidebar ul li ul {
	margin-bottom: 20px;
}

#calendar_wrap {
	margin-bottom: 20px;
}


div.textwidget {
	margin: 10px 0;
}

h3.widgettitle, #sidebar h2 {
	font-size: 18px;
	padding-bottom: 7px;
	color: #e0d0a9;
	border-bottom: 1px solid #9F5523;
}



/* search */

form#searchform {
	margin-bottom: 20px;
}

label.hidden {display: none;}

input#s {
	width: 190px;
}

input.submit, input#searchsubmit {
	background: #9F5523;
	border: none;
	color: #fff;
	padding: 2px 5px 3px;
	font-size: 12px;
	margin-left: 5px;
	-moz-border-radius: 3px;
	-khtml-border-radius: 3px;
	-webkit-border-radius: 3px;

}



/**** footer ****/

#footer {
}

#footer img {
	border:none;
}

#footer a {
	color: #fff;
}

#footer p {
	line-height: 16px;
}


#foot-left {
	margin-top: 20px;
	margin-left: 25px;
	float:left;
	width: 400px;
}

#foot-middle {
	margin-top: 20px;
	float:left;
	width: 200px;
	margin-left: 40px;
}


p#readmore {
	font-family: Museo-Slab, Palatino, serif;
	font-size: 16px;
	text-align: right;
	}


#foot-right {
	margin-top: 20px;
	float:left;
	width: 255px;
	margin-left: 65px;

}




img.h4 {
	margin-bottom: 20px;
}



#footer div.small {
	text-align: center;
	font-size: 10px;
}




/** port styles **/

div.description {
	float: right;
	width: 390px;
	
}	

.description h2 {
	font-family: Museo-Slab, Palatino, serif;
	font-size: 28px;
	color:#9F5523;
}

.description p {
	color:#E0D0A9;
	font-size: 16px;
	margin-bottom: 10px;
}


.dots {
	position: absolute;
	bottom: 21px;
	left: 275px;
}


div.rule {
border-bottom:1px solid #503826;
clear:both;
padding-top: 20px;
margin-bottom:40px;

}


.carousel-list li embed {
	width: 496px;
	margin-left: 0px;
	border: 8px solid #503826;
}

#workbutton {
float: right;margin: 20px -10px 0 0px;
}





